It's true what TiAL says, there are oil shaft rings but there are no "seals" in turbochargers. As for purchasing this turbo, you're making a BIG mistake, and would basically be using it as a paper weight or door stop, or to reuse the housings and backplates, but that's if you know what you're doing. The lack of the proper oil restictor on a GT-R series means that there was too much oil splaying in the cartridge. Now, that does mean that the turbo is possibly still workable, in that it can be cleaned, use the right restrictor, and it could possibly work. But that is an optimistic viewpoint if you already OWN the turbocharger; not buying it from someone else. If you're wrong, and the oil destroyed the turbine shaft ring, than you may just as well have given a nigerian e-mail spammer $800 for the buying it from this person.
Honestly, its not worth the hassle, especially when there are alternatives that are similar brand new for $1000 like the GT3540S.

why don't the ball bearing CHRAs have a small orifice inboard of the feed location? Seems like if Garrett knew that they never wanted an overabundance of oil flow in there because it would ruin the CHRA, they just would have done that as others do?
As far as turbine shaft oil rings go, what ordinarily gets damaged when there is "over-oiling", which results in oil burning? Seems to me as if oil being forced out between the shaft and ring wouldn't be that big of a deal, as there would be no contact between those surfaces then. . . . . No?
As far as turbine shaft oil rings go, what ordinarily gets damaged when there is "over-oiling", which results in oil burning? Seems to me as if oil being forced out between the shaft and ring wouldn't be that big of a deal, as there would be no contact between those surfaces then. . . . . No?
Garrett thought that all installs would be handled properly by professionals that would make sure the oil feed met both the minimum and maximum pressures they spec for each particular turbo. Not Joe Schmoe slapping a random -4an feed on a non-turbo engine getting the oil through an unfiltered 3rd party sandwich adapter, never knowing what pressure the turbo's oil is at. If you make a quick search, the majority of "my turbo's blown" threads are from people that fit that exact description. I can't ever recall any of those people checking the oil pressure right at the turbo's inlet. VERY infrequently do you see it from someone who's fabricated (not simply installed) >100 custom turbo kits - someone who know's what to do.
Also, some OEM's restrict the oil pressure before the oil feed line, which would lead to oil starvation on those cars if Garrett installed a Honda-safe restrictor.
